The Hangman

Reliability Rating: low/moderate

The hangman (karakasa, or paper umbrella), consists of a small body (either color) with a very long lower shadow. This pattern is typically found at the top or bottoms of trends. When the pattern occurs at the top of a up trend it is called a hangman (when it is found at the bottom of a down trend it is called a hammer).

candle18a The hangman can be either a black or a white candle.

Long-legged shadows' doji candlestick

Reliability Rating: moderate

This candle has no body, the open and the close is identical. This signal shows that the trend has run it's course and it will reverse. The trend will reverse quickly after this signal occurs. It is considered a reliable signal.
